What is organic food?

Organic food is produced using environmentally and socially responsible methods that prioritise soil health, biodiversity, and animal welfare. This means that organic farms avoid synthetic fertilizers and pesticides, genetically modified organisms (GMOs), and antibiotics and growth hormones in livestock.

In the United States, organic farms must be certified by the USDA National Organic Program (NOP), which sets strict standards for organic production and labelling.

The science behind organic food

Several studies have compared the nutritional content of organic and conventional (non-organic) foods, with mixed results. Some studies have found that organic food contains higher levels of certain nutrients, while others have found no significant differences.

One meta-analysis published in the British Journal of Nutrition in 2014 analyzed data from 343 studies and concluded that organic crops had higher levels of several beneficial compounds, including antioxidants, vitamins, and minerals. However, the differences were generally small and may not have a significant impact on human health.

Another study published in the Journal of Agricultural and Food Chemistry in 2012 found that organic blueberries had significantly higher levels of total antioxidants and anthocyanins (compounds that give blueberries their colour and have been linked to numerous health benefits) than conventional blueberries. However, the study did not find any differences in the levels of other nutrients like vitamin C or iron.

One possible explanation for these mixed results is that the nutrient content of food is influenced by many factors, including the variety of the plant, the soil it’s grown in, the climate, and the stage of ripeness at harvest. Organic production methods may have a positive impact on some of these factors, but not others.

The benefits of organic food

While the nutritional differences between organic and conventional food may be small, there are other potential benefits to choosing organic:

Lower pesticide exposure: Organic farms avoid synthetic pesticides, which have been linked to a range of health problems, including cancer, neurological damage, and developmental delays in children.

Better animal welfare: Organic livestock are raised in conditions that prioritise their well-being, including access to the outdoors, pasture, and organic feed.

Reduced environmental impact: Organic farming methods prioritise soil health, biodiversity, and conservation of natural resources, which can help mitigate climate change and protect ecosystems.
